If not, see <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>. */ package twitter4j.http; import java.io.IOException; import java.io.InputStream; import java.util.zip.GZIPInputStream; public final class StreamingGZIPInputStream extends GZIPInputStream { private final InputStream wrapped; public StreamingGZIPInputStream(final InputStream is) throws IOException { super(is); wrapped = is; } /** * Overrides behavior of GZIPInputStream which assumes we have all the data * available which is not true for streaming. We instead rely on the * underlying stream to tell us how much data is available. * <p> * Programs should not count on this method to return the actual number of * bytes that could be read without blocking. * * @return - whatever the wrapped InputStream returns * @exception java.io.IOException if an I/O error occurs. */ @Override public int available() throws IOException { return wrapped.available(); } }
